I used rustoleum on your gtp
 
2 coats of VHT, and 5 coats of clear, lots of wet sanding and buffing. 2 coats comes out as darker looking in the shade, lighter in the direct sun. i like them cause you can see the lights in the day time. stock bulbs too.
